Output 2b346f21b1ae591a10aa0f61377766b8cf681ced51cb76dd7a4a1c6be058f925:7

value
14422597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3637ee7d371a18f3e2a3571d44a80bd84338781b OP_EQUAL
address
36dhR6eUhNh6ndGKsB5WB4SwjU23w7SrWw
transaction
2b346f21b1ae591a10aa0f61377766b8cf681ced51cb76dd7a4a1c6be058f925
confirmations
197061
spent
true